A Managed Service Provider in Plymouth is seeking a motivated 1st Line Service Desk Engineer. This full-time role features a hybrid working model, allowing two days of remote work each week.
Responsibilities include:
- Providing first-line technical support
- Troubleshooting IT issues
- Managing support tickets
Candidates should have strong communication skills, a customer-first attitude, and prior experience in IT support. The role offers excellent training and clear progression opportunities.

How to prepare for a job interview at Set2Recruit
✨Know Your Tech Basics
Brush up on your technical knowledge related to IT support. Be ready to discuss common troubleshooting steps for issues like network connectivity or software problems. This will show that you’re not just a people person but also technically savvy.
✨Show Off Your Communication Skills
Since strong communication is key for this role, practice explaining complex tech concepts in simple terms. You might be asked to describe how you would help a non-technical user with an issue, so think of examples from your past experience.
✨Demonstrate a Customer-First Attitude
Prepare to share instances where you went above and beyond for a customer. Highlight your problem-solving skills and how you prioritised the user's needs, as this aligns perfectly with the company’s values.
✨Ask About Training and Growth Opportunities
Since the role offers excellent training and progression, come prepared with questions about these opportunities. This shows your enthusiasm for personal development and commitment to growing within the company.
